Formal Specification Best Practices

Specification

Formal specification best practices, within cryptocurrency, options trading, and financial derivatives, represent a rigorous approach to defining system behavior and contractual obligations. These practices emphasize unambiguous, machine-readable descriptions of rules, constraints, and expected outcomes, moving beyond informal documentation. Precise specifications are crucial for automated execution, risk management, and dispute resolution, particularly in decentralized environments where trust is minimized. A well-defined specification serves as a foundational element for smart contract development, algorithmic trading strategies, and regulatory compliance.